    Over the last year I've traveled solo in the camper van as well as with my partner and have driven it over 60,000km (37,500 miles) crossing parts of Canada and the United States. This 1989 GMC Vanguard Vandura named Bertha has been through it all! Sandy deserts to snowy mountains and she's held up quite well considering!
    Over the last year the van has traveled through Alberta, British Columbia (and Vancouver Island), Washington, Oregon, California, Arizona, Nevada, Utah, Wyoming, Idaho and Montana. This included a 100 day bucket-list road trip through the States, but the majority of my time was spent on Vancouver Island and lower mainland Vancouver and Squamish.
    My biggest lesson I learned this year living in a van was that "happiness is only real when shared" which is a quote from Christopher McCandless. I loved solo for 7 months and that's why I wanted to get into vanlife in the first place. So explore and travel solo as I had always loved that in the past. But as time passed without communicating or seeing anyone I knew, my uring for solitude turned to wanting to share these incredible moments and places I am seeing. Leah moving into the van for 100 days brought new life into the van life for me and reinvigorated my passion for travel.
    I learned and saw many beautiful things and places this year. But none more important than life is meant to be shared.
